"After visiting the Charlottenburg castle I was hungry and discovered together with my friends close to the subway station Richard-Wagner-Platz (U7) this small restaurant. As a starter I ordered vegetarian spring rolls. They came with the typical fish sauce as a dip and some salad. These rolls made of rice paper and filled with vegetables, tofu and herbs were really delicious. After this I ordered as the main course a vegetarian tomato soup that is not in the menu and was a recommendation of the cook and owner from the restaurant. This soup was huge and very delicious because of a very fine taste and aroma made of some special Vietnamese herbs, lemon grass, vegetables and tofu. A nice Vietnamese tea was included. To finish this wonderful meal I had a Mango shake (Lassi) prepared with coconut milk. My friends who are not vegetarians ordered Goi Bo from the menu which is a vietnamese meat salad made of grilled meat on a blend of salad and Vietnamese herbs and a ginger-lime dressing and the classic Pho Bo soup and Wantan soup. It felt like a short trip to Vietnam. We all were really surprised about the taste and quality of all the food and at the end of the low prices on the bill."
